Date and time formatting?

Open jjnxpct opened this issue 7 years ago • 7 comments

Is there a way to format the date in the 'day' view where the hours are shown? And also, can we change the formatting of the time to 24 hours? Without the AM/PM?

Without the AM/PM?

{
    ...,
    ampm: false
}

This is what I have:

using simply:

    .calendar({
        type: 'datetime',
        ampm: false,
        monthFirst: false
    });
